Maintenance Engineer

Maintenance Engineer (kacwsc) Northamptonshire, England

We are currently looking to recruit two multi skilled Maintenance Engineers to work in Northampton.

You will need to be Electrically bias working in a manufacturing site providing site support for preventative and reactive site maintenance with an on-going effort to eliminate faults and variation within our processes and deliver right first-time products.

Roles and responsibilities

  • Carry out daily planned and unplanned duties as instructed by the Engineering Manager or Shift Manager
  • Respond to machinery breakdowns as and when they occur, prioritised by production requirements and allotted work schedule.
  • Carry out planned repairs to site and plant equipment as required to manufacturers standards
  • Ensure continued operation of water processing and material blending operations through PPM activities / repairs
  • Complete allotted tasks in a timely and safe fashion so as to maximise factory output and minimise downtime.
  • Record all required information and update technical documentation for all operations as per company works instructions/procedures.
  • Cooperate with and lead improvement project activities
  • Alert relevant people to process and engineering concerns and proactively identify opportunities for improvement.
  • Agree and complete training and development requirements as determined by the Engineering Manager and the training plan.
  • Transfer the knowledge and skills among the team and Operators
  • Correct use and safeguarding of property issued by the company.
  • Ensure workplace is clean and tidy – all housekeeping procedures followed, associated with tasks.
  • Creation / updating of standard operating procedures and risk assessments
  • Undertake other reasonable duties as and when required.
